Fassbrause Cherry

A 0.0% naturally fermented cherry beer drink from Estonia, blending 50% alcohol-free beer with cherry juice and B vitamins for a lightly fruity, low-calorie alternative to soft drinks.

About This Drink

Fassbrause is a German style that A. Le Coq has adopted for its non-alcoholic range: part beer, part juice, all fizz. The Cherry version is half alcohol-free beer and half water and cherry juice, with a small shot of thyme extract and carrot concentrate adding a faint herbal complexity behind the fruit. At 31 kcal per 100ml and 5.8g of sugar, it sits well below most fruit-flavoured soft drinks on both counts. The beer base brings a light grain character and hop bitterness that stops it tasting like a straightforward cordial. The cherry is present but not syrupy - more tart than sweet, with the carbonation keeping things lively. A. Le Coq adds B vitamins (B6, B12, B5, B7) across the Fassbrause range, which puts it in the functional drinks category without being preachy about it. It's a credible mid-afternoon option - more interesting than sparkling water, less sweet than most alternatives. Available in a 500ml bottle.

Ingredients

Alcohol-free beer (water, barley malt, hop) 50%, water, sugar, carbon dioxide, citric acid, cherry juice from concentrated juice 1%, vegetable oil, carrot concentrate, thyme extract, flavourings, vitamins (B6, B12, pantothenic acid, biotin), stabiliser (E414), preservative (sodium benzoate)
